As the digital era continues to advance, so do the responsibilities of a UX professional. Collaborating with Design experts, these experts are central in creating the user experience of goods and services.

A User Experience Designer takes care of improving user satisfaction by optimizing the functionality and interaction between the user and the service. Sometimes mistaken for the Design expert role, the two share common ground but are not the same.

Seen primarily in digital products, a Design expert's job incorporates ideas from UX/UI Design, visual design, and user interaction to make a efficient and beautiful design.

A UX expert centers their time on the user— understanding their requirements, choices, and habits through an assortment of research methods. This tactic, known as User-Centered Design, sees to it the creation is made with the consumer's needs and experience in mind.

The creation of a design guide— a thorough set of components, principles, and design standards— is another duty of UX Designers. This set aids in sustaining uniformity across multiple products and boosts workflow.

Prototipagem and usability testing are key steps in the design process. A model is a initial version of the creation that serves to spot potential problems and areas for improvement. User testing are then performed to evaluate the design's effectiveness and ease of use.

The understanding and organization of information— known as information architecture— serves to enhance the product's usability and customer experience.

Finally, reviews from actual users— garnered through user surveys— provides priceless information that aid in refinements and future product evolution.

Tools such as Figma, a cloud-based design and prototyping tool—are useful resources for User Experience Designers, Design System aiding in collaborative work and distributing designs with ease.

In summary, the duties of a User Experience Designer and Design expert provide an indispensable addition to the creation, evolution, and improvement of designs. Through a comprehensive approach, involving design, research, and testing, they guarantee creations are meet user needs, user-friendly, and efficient.
